Dhemaji: Assam chief minister Himanta Biswa Sarma inaugurated three new bridges in Dhemaji on Thursday. Assam CM Sarma visited Dhemaji especially for the inauguration of these much-needed bridges.

All these three bridges were built under different schemes of the central and the state government.

Under the Pradhan Mantri Gram Sadak Yojna (PMGSY 2017-2018) scheme, the first inaugurated bridge occupies the Fatiha-Bardubi rivulet. It flows along the Bengenagora-Kothalguri road.

The next bridge has been constructed under the Pradhan Mantri Gram Sadak Yojna (PMGSY 2018-2019) scheme. It connects the Dusutimukh village to the Kaitong village.

The third bridge has been constructed over the Batua river. It flows along the Batua-Rangkup road. This bridge has been made under the Chief Minister's special scheme.

Assam CM Sarma was accompanied by Education Minister Ranoj Pegu, Finance and Social Welfare Minister Ajanta Neog, including Member of Parliament Pradan Baruah in the inauguration ceremony.

Assam chief minister Sarma took to Twitter to share the news. The post read, "Improving road connectivity across the state is crucial for holistic economic growth. Inaugurated 3 bridges in Dhemaji today. Over Fatiha-Bardubi rivulet on Bengenagora-Kothalguri road (PMGSY 2017-18). Dusutimukh-Kaitong connecting bridge (PMGSY 2018-19)."

He added, "Over Batua River on Batua- Rangkup road under CM's Special Package. Compliments to the PWD team! Ministers @ranojpeguassam, @AjantaNeog & MP @PradanBaruah also joined."
